Why is ENFP called the champion?

The ENFP personality type is also called the "Champion" because of this type's enthusiasm for helping others realize their dreams. Other nicknames for the ENFP include: The Imaginative Motivator (MBTI) The Campaigner (16Personalities)

Is ENFP a champion?

Referred to as the “Champion” or “Encourager” personality type, ENFP stands for the four cognitive functions that help this group of individuals process information and make decisions. This acronym stands for extraverted, intuitive, feeling, and perceiving — serving as one of the core MBTI personality types.

How rare is ENFP female?

ENFP is a moderately common personality type, and is the fifth most common among women. ENFPs make up: 8% of the general population. 10% of women.
